DAY THREE – Beamish

Today we visit the famous Beamish North of England Open Air Museum, capturing the spirit of the North East in the 1800s and 1900s. Attractions include a restored tram and replica bus rides, an authentic town street, a colliery village, a trip down the mine, an oldfashioned sweet shop, a working farm, steam locomotives, and much more.

 

DAY FOUR – Hopetown Museum and Head of Steam & Locomotion Visitor Centre

Today we embark on a journey through railway history. We begin with a visit to Hopetown Museum for a guided tour. A newly restored museum on the site of the Darlington & Stockton Railway the first passenger transport line when it was opened in 1825. This momentous event led to the development of nearly 15,000 miles of passenger lines over the next 40 years. The site showcases how trains opened a gateway for the lower classes at the time to travel and see sights outside of their local area. Later, we head to Shildon and Locomotion - the National Railway Experience and home to many famous locomotives, including the one that hauled the first passenger train.
